In the evolving landscape of digital media, users are increasingly turning to alternatives that allow them more control and flexibility over their viewing experiences. One such option is the Android TV box, a versatile device that can stream content, run apps, and even play games.
However, tech enthusiasts often seek to maximize their devices’ potential by installing Linux on these boxes. This article will explore how to flash an Android TV box with Linux, detailing the benefits, preparation, process, and practical tips for getting the most out of your Linux experience.
Understanding Android TV Boxes
What is an Android TV Box?
To grasp the significance of flashing an Android TV box with Linux, it’s crucial to first understand what an Android TV box is. This section introduces the concept, its functionality, and its appeal to users who want a more integrated media experience.
An Android TV box is a streaming device that utilizes the Android operating system to deliver a wide array of media content. These boxes connect to televisions via HDMI and provide users with access to numerous streaming platforms such as Netflix, Hulu, YouTube, and more.
They are designed to enhance the home entertainment experience, offering various features and functionalities that traditional televisions do not support.
Key Features of Android TV Boxes:
Feature | Description |
---|---|
Operating System | Based on Android OS, often customized by manufacturers |
Connectivity | Supports Wi-Fi, Ethernet, HDMI, and sometimes Bluetooth |
Resolution | Supports up to 4K Ultra HD resolution |
Storage Options | Varies from 8GB to 64GB or more, often expandable via microSD |
How Does Flashing Work?
Flashing is a technical process that can seem daunting at first. This section clarifies what flashing involves and why it is a significant step for users looking to enhance their Android TV box functionality.
Flashing refers to the process of overwriting a device’s operating system firmware. In the case of Android TV boxes, this involves replacing the existing Android OS with a Linux distribution. This change can offer enhanced performance, improved security, and additional features not typically available on standard Android.
Benefits of Flashing Linux onto an Android TV Box
Understanding the benefits of switching to Linux can motivate users to make the transition. This section outlines the primary advantages of flashing Linux, showcasing its appeal and potential.
Flashing an Android TV box with Linux presents numerous advantages that can significantly enrich the user experience. Here are some notable benefits:
Benefit | Description |
---|---|
Customization | Linux provides extensive customization options. |
Enhanced Performance | Linux often runs more efficiently than Android. |
Improved Security | Linux is generally less vulnerable to malware. |
Access to Open Source Apps | Users can leverage a wide range of open-source applications. |
Preparing to Flash Your Android TV Box
Preparation is key to a successful flashing process. This section outlines the essential steps needed to get ready for flashing your Android TV box, ensuring that you have everything in place before starting.
Research Your Device
Before diving into the flashing process, it’s crucial to conduct thorough research on your specific Android TV box. This initial step will help you identify any compatibility issues and gather necessary information.
- Identify Your Device Model: Locate the model number on the box or within the settings menu.
- Check Compatibility: Research community forums and resources (like XDA Developers) to verify that your device supports Linux flashing.
Backup Your Data
Flashing your device will erase all existing data, making backups essential. This section highlights the importance of creating a backup and how to execute it effectively.
To avoid losing important files, it’s vital to back up your information:
- Create a Backup: Utilize built-in tools or third-party applications to save your data securely.
- Export Settings: Document any significant configurations or settings you wish to retain.
Download Necessary Tools and Files
Equipping yourself with the right tools and files is critical for a smooth flashing experience. This section lists everything you need to gather before starting the process.
To flash Linux onto your Android TV box, you will require specific tools and files:
Required Tool/File | Description |
---|---|
Linux Distribution | Choose a compatible Linux distribution (e.g., Ubuntu, Debian). |
Flashing Tool | Software like ADB (Android Debug Bridge) or tools specific to your device. |
USB Drive | A USB drive (usually 8GB or more) to create a bootable disk if necessary. |
Prepare Your Computer
Ensuring your computer is set up correctly will facilitate the flashing process. This section outlines the requirements for your PC to ensure compatibility and readiness.
Ensure your PC is ready for the flashing process:
Requirement | Description |
---|---|
Operating System | Use Windows, macOS, or Linux. |
USB Ports | Ensure available USB ports for device connection. |
Install Required Software | Install any necessary drivers or software for the flashing process. |
Flashing Your Android TV Box with Linux
With all preparations complete, it’s time to begin the actual process of flashing your Android TV box. This section provides a step-by-step guide, making it easier for you to follow along.
Connect Your Android TV Box to Your Computer
The first step in flashing is establishing a connection between your Android TV box and your computer. This section guides you through the necessary connections.
Use a USB cable to connect your Android TV box to your computer. Make sure that the device is powered on and recognized by your PC.
Enter Recovery Mode
Entering recovery mode is crucial for flashing your device. This section explains how to boot your Android TV box into recovery mode, a necessary step before flashing.
To flash Linux, you may need to boot your Android TV box into recovery mode. The method can vary by device, but commonly involves:
- Powering Off the Device: Completely turn off your Android TV box.
- Pressing Specific Buttons: Hold a combination of buttons (usually the power button + volume up) while powering on to enter recovery mode.
Flash Linux Distribution
Now that you are in recovery mode, it’s time to start flashing the Linux distribution. This section breaks down the steps involved in this critical phase.
Once in recovery mode, follow these steps to flash your selected Linux distribution:
- Load the Flashing Tool: Open the flashing tool on your computer (like ADB).
- Run Flash Commands: Execute the necessary commands to flash the Linux image to your device.
Reboot Your Device
After the flashing process is complete, rebooting your device is essential. This section emphasizes the importance of this step in finalizing the installation.
After the flashing process is complete, reboot your Android TV box. It should now boot into the newly installed Linux environment.
Initial Setup
The first boot into Linux requires some configuration. This section outlines the essential initial setup steps you’ll need to complete.
Upon first boot, you’ll need to complete the initial setup steps, which typically include:
Setup Step | Description |
---|---|
Language Selection | Choose your preferred language. |
Network Configuration | Connect to Wi-Fi or Ethernet. |
User Account Creation | Set up a user account if prompted. |
Exploring Linux on Your Android TV Box
Once Linux is up and running, it’s time to delve into its functionalities. This section introduces the key features and capabilities that Linux brings to your Android TV box.
Installing Software and Applications
Linux provides access to a wide array of software and applications. This section explains how to install applications that can enhance your Android TV box experience.
One of the main advantages of using Linux is the vast repository of software available. Here’s how to get started with installations:
Installation Method | Description |
---|---|
Using Package Managers | Utilize package managers like APT (for Debian-based distros) or YUM (for RedHat-based). |
Downloading from Repositories | Access official repositories to download applications and tools easily. |
Enhancing Your User Experience
To fully enjoy your Linux installation, consider personalizing and enhancing your setup. This section offers practical tips for optimizing your Linux experience on the Android TV box.
To maximize your experience, consider the following suggestions:
- Customize the Desktop Environment: Alter themes, icons, and layouts to suit your preferences.
- Install Media Centers: Software like Kodi can transform your Android TV box into a full-fledged media center.
- Explore Gaming Options: Seek out Linux-compatible games to broaden your entertainment options.
Troubleshooting Common Issues
As with any technology, you may encounter some issues while using Linux. This section addresses common problems and provides potential solutions to help you troubleshoot effectively.
While using Linux on your Android TV box can be beneficial, you may encounter some challenges. Here are common issues and their solutions:
Issue | Potential Solution |
---|---|
Device Not Booting | Ensure the flashing process completed without errors and check the integrity of the Linux image. |
Driver Issues | Install missing drivers or verify compatibility with the Linux distribution. |
Network Connectivity Issues | Check network settings and confirm proper drivers are installed. |
Conclusion
Flashing your Android TV box with Linux can unlock a world of possibilities, transforming it into a versatile media device. By following the proper preparation and flashing procedures, you can enjoy a customized experience tailored to your entertainment and productivity needs.
This article has provided an in-depth exploration of the flashing process, including the advantages, steps, and potential challenges involved. Embracing Linux on your Android TV box not only enhances your viewing experience but also opens the door to endless opportunities for customization and functionality.
As you venture into this exciting realm, continue to seek information from online communities and resources to optimize your Linux experience. Share your thoughts, experiences, and questions in the comments below, and embrace the journey of unlocking endless possibilities with your Android TV box!
FAQs:
What is an Android TV box?
An Android TV box is a digital media player that runs on the Android operating system, allowing users to stream content from various sources, access apps, and enjoy multimedia on their TVs. These devices offer features similar to smart TVs but can be more versatile and customizable.
Why would I want to flash my Android TV box with Linux?
Flashing your Android TV box with Linux can enhance its performance, provide a more customizable interface, and allow access to a wider range of applications and features that may not be available on the default Android OS. Linux can also improve system stability and security.
Is flashing my Android TV box safe?
Flashing your Android TV box is generally safe if you follow the correct procedures and use reliable software and firmware. However, improper flashing can lead to issues like bricking the device or voiding warranties, so it’s crucial to research thoroughly and back up any important data.
What do I need to prepare before flashing my Android TV box?
Before flashing your Android TV box, ensure you have the following: a compatible Linux distribution for your device, a USB drive or SD card for installation, the necessary flashing software, and a reliable internet connection. It’s also advisable to back up any existing data on your device.
What should I do if I encounter issues after flashing my Android TV box?
If you encounter issues after flashing, try troubleshooting by checking connections, reinstalling drivers, or resetting the device to factory settings. Consult online forums, user manuals, or support communities specific to your device and the Linux distribution for tailored solutions.
Are you considering upgrading your entertainment setup? An Android TV box with Linux could be the perfect solution for enhancing your viewing experience. These devices offer flexibility and versatility, allowing you to stream content from various platforms while enjoying the benefits of a Linux operating system. With an Android TV box, you can access a wide range of apps, including popular streaming services, games, and productivity tools.
Linux-based Android TV boxes are known for their stability and security, making them an excellent choice for tech enthusiasts. They often provide a smoother user interface and faster performance compared to traditional setups. Whether you want to binge-watch your favorite series, play games, or browse the web, an Android TV box can do it all.
To learn more about the best Android TV boxes with Linux available in 2024, check out this detailed guide: Android TV Box with Linux.
Credited website: https://www.gov.uk/